Synopsis Twelve Crimes that Shocked the Nation by : Alan Whiticker

Some crimes shock an entire nation, and in doing so, define us for all time. In Australia the twelve infamous crimes detailed in this book have become part of our cultural landscape - 'Gatton', 'Pyjama Girl', 'Shark-Arm', 'Brown-Out', 'Thorne Kidnapping', 'Backpacker' and 'Snowtown' - each name has become synonymous with our unique criminal heritage. And when normal police methods fail to produce answers, as in the 'Bogle-Chandler' Mystery, the 'Wanda Beach Murders', the disappearance of the 'Beaumont Children' and more recently, the 'Norfolk Island' case, the crimes take on almost an urban mythology where fact and fiction become difficult to separate. But more than that, these events - and our reaction to them - reveal more about Australian society than we may care to know.

Synopsis Famous Detective Stories by : National Library of Australia

From the notorious Louisa Collins in 1880s NSW, who murdered two husbands with rat poison, to a blazing shootout featuring prominent underworld figure Antonio Martini at Taronga Zoo in the 1940s, this book features stories of true crimes that shocked and thrilled the Australian public. Published as pulp fiction in the early 1950s, the original Famous Detective Stories catalogued murders, robberies, love triangles and great escapes. Here, each story is paired with the often sensationalist newspaper cuttings of the time.
